Cost to hire an auto locksmith

The cost of hiring a locksmith for your vehicle is contingent on the kind of service you require. A basic service, such as opening a trunk in your car can cost between $60 to $200. Reprogramming transponder key transponders, for instance, could be more expensive and could cost as high as $400. This kind of service should only be performed when absolutely necessary. Qualifications of a car locksmith

The basic education and training needed for a successful career as a car locksmith is typically gained through an apprenticeship. Although formal qualifications are useful for certifying, they are not as useful for teaching the person learning how to do it. Practical skills are acquired through practice and on-the-job experience. For instance, an apprentice must complete an apprenticeship before being able to work independently. Then, they may qualify for a certified locksmith designation from the Associated Locksmiths of America trade association.

In Illinois you need to hold an official license from the state to work as a locksmith, and be able to pass an exam. The state is responsible for regulating certifications, and ALOA is the authority. Candidates who are successful receive the designations Certified Automotive Locksmith, Registered Locksmith, and Certified Master Safe Tech. Certification may require applicants to undergo a background check, as well as submit fingerprints. Depending on your state, you can be licensed to offer locksmith services in the space of a few months or weeks after graduating.

Some states have professional locksmith associations. ALOA is the largest association. ALOA also offers guides and continuing education courses for those seeking to become locksmiths.
